Subject: Quickstore 4.2 — bloom filter now fronts the KV layer

Plugin authors: starting with this release, Quickstore places a bloom filter ahead of the key-value store. Negative lookups return faster; false positives fall through safely. No API changes are required on your side. Verify your plugin against the staging build referenced below.

session token of fahif-tadup = htk3_9c7

MEMO — Kettling Depot Receiving

Uniform sets for the new Kettling depot arrive Wednesday via Ashgrove courier: 40 boxes, sorted by size, manifest attached to box one. Check the count at the dock before signing; shortages go straight to stores, not the courier. The hand-over instruction the courier will follow is set out below.

drop instructions, tafof-baguf: the holmir gilox courier leaves the sormir ulaok holdor ledger at gate 5596 under passcode 257343

## Retry failed exports with backoff

Exports to Glacierbox were failing silently when the sink hiccuped. This PR adds jittered exponential backoff and a dead-letter shelf for anything that exhausts retries. Nothing fancy — mostly plumbing in the Ferndale worker. Tested against the flaky-sink simulator and it recovers cleanly. The retry knobs are configured here.

tuning table, yajog-yahof:
BUDGETS = {
    "lamvan": 303,
    "wenox": 460,
    "fenvan": 525,
}

### Querying the Shaftline Simulator

When a customer reports weird dispatch behavior, you can replay their scenario against the Shaftline simulator directly — no need to loop in engineering for basic cases. Hit the `/replay` endpoint with the scenario ID from the support console and it'll return the car assignments step by step. Requests to the simulator need auth, so include the support team's shared key, shown below.

API key for bajeg-yafog: kto3_eo8

## Transporting Water Samples — Merrowfall Reservoir

Quick reminder for the records crew: the sample bottles from Merrowfall are chain-of-custody items, same as documents. Each cooler gets a custody card, and yes, you sign it every single time it changes hands. Keep coolers upright, ice packs topped up, and don't leave them in the van over lunch — the lab at Ashgrove Analytics will reject warm samples. Book collection through the usual courier form. The hand-over instruction for the courier sits right below this section.

handover note for yagef-bagep: the drudor pelius courier leaves the kasdor zorvan norir ledger at gate 8016 under passcode 755406